Robert Half is recruiting Associate Attorney for a top-regarded, mid-sized personal injury law firm with a beautiful office in the East Bay. The firm is well-regarded for its commitment to its deserving clientele and the achievement of excellent results (verdicts and settlements) for them and their families.
The following are the qualifications for the Associate opportunity:
• 1-3+ years of civil litigation experience, preferably in a personal injury or products liability practice;
• Good range of case management experience, including intake, preparation of complaints, discovery, some taking and defending depositions (preferred, but not required), law and motion, drafting / opposing dispositive motions (e.g., MSJs/MSAs), and ideally trial preparation, mediation, and settlement negotiation experience;
• Plaintiff-side experience is preferred, but associates with defense experience are encouraged to apply if they have a proven interest in prosecuting injured workers’ / consumers’ rights;
• Persuasive legal writing and advocacy skills;
• Spanish language fluency is a big plus;
• Willing and able to travel often to meet clients, attend depositions, and make court appearances; and
• Active and in good standing with the State Bar of California.
